Transaction 22a66f6c8d8d84c83728684f2e715cbeb3a7a078f595c44dff580d625f2f5d03
1 Input
1 Output
-
22a66f6c8d8d84c83728684f2e715cbeb3a7a078f595c44dff580d625f2f5d03:0
- value
- 62264
- script pubkey
- OP_0 OP_PUSHBYTES_20 672d7df233007672a757a122d733c54ecf178ec1
- address
- bc1qvukhmu3nqpm89f6h5y3dwv79fm830rkp54pstg